WebThe world of forensics suffers from fragmentation, skills shortages, an unstable marketplace and lack of investment and accreditation. But NPCC Forensics Lead and Dorset Chief Constable James Vaughan says police forces can make a bright future for forensics – with help from the new Forensics Capability Network (FCN). WebThe CTSFO standard is the highest Authorised Firearms Officer level in the National Police Firearms Training Curriculum (NPFTC) and was established by the Metropolitan Police Service in the lead up to the 2012 Summer Olympics held in London on 27th of July. Web1 mrt. 2016 · The new national gun crime investigation manual for police forces was officially launched on 26 February. Chief Constable David Thompson, NPCC lead for criminal use of firearms, launched the manual at a conference in Birmingham. The event featured speakers from various police forces, as well as the National Crime Agency and …

Web6 apr. 2024 · Legislation provides offences to respond to the sale, possession and use of weapons to tackle serious crime. Knives, blades and corrosive substances may be treated as offensive weapons or dealt with under specific provisions.
